text: Copella eigenmanni is a species of fish in the splashing tetra family found along the Atlantic coast between Pará to Delta Amacuro, the mouth of the Orinoco. They grow no more than a few centimeters. The fish is named in honor of ichthyologist Carl H. Eigenmann (1863-1927), who collected the type specimen.
